DOWAGIAC — The Beckwith Theatre Company is bringing the gripping psychological thriller “Sleuth” to the stage, with performances running from Nov. 6 through Nov. 10.

The play, written by Anthony Shaffer and directed by Jeff Gunn, is set in a cozy English country house. The story follows celebrated mystery writer Andrew Wyke as he confronts Milo Tindle, a younger man who has fallen in love with Wyke’s wife. What begins as a civil conversation quickly spirals into a dangerous game of wits and deception.
